Delaware Valley Doberman Pinscher Assistance Inc
| Fiscal year | Revenue | Expenses | Net | Reserve mo. | Staff % |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2011 | 55,960 | 55,719 | 241 | 0.5 | 0% |
| 2012 | 63,689 | 54,652 | 9,037 | 2.5 | 0% |
| 2013 | 55,275 | 57,076 | −1,801 | 2.0 | 0% |
| 2014 | 57,899 | 56,872 | 1,027 | 2.2 | 0% |
| 2015 | 49,294 | 49,348 | −54 | 1.7 | 0% |
| 2016 | 35,349 | 45,093 | −9,744 | 0.0 | 0% |
| 2017 | 53,844 | 39,878 | 13,966 | 3.6 | 0% |
| 2018 | 69,936 | 59,173 | 10,763 | 4.7 | 0% |
| 2019 | 70,404 | 71,538 | −1,134 | 3.7 | 0% |
| 2020 | 41,176 | 44,733 | −3,557 | 5.1 | 0% |
| 2023 | 265,466 | 87,372 | 178,094 | 25.4 | 0% |
In its most recent public year (2023), this organization brought in $178,094 more than it spent. Its reserves stood at about 25.4 months of spending, up from 0.5 in 2011. Staff pay was 0% of spending.
Reserve months = net assets ÷ average monthly spending; net assets count everything the organization owns beyond its debts — buildings and donor-restricted funds included, not just cash. Staff pay = salaries, wages, and officer compensation; it excludes benefits and payroll taxes. The IRS releases this data years after the fact — this organization's newest public year is 2023.
